Akure og Lundey øerne, kun få minutter fra Reykjaviks gamle havn, er hjemsted for en af Islands største puffin kolonier. Du vil nå den med RIB speedboat - udstyret i overalls, briller, handsker og en redningsjakke - og komme tæt nok til at se puffins på stenene og i luften, mens din guide forklarer deres vaner, deres huler, og hvorfor Islands kystlinje passer dem så godt.

Efter at have mødt din guide, går du ombord på en af vores to hurtige og sjove RIB-speedbåde til et krydstogt til Lundey eller Akurey, en ø kendt for sin lundebestand, lige ud for Reykjaviks kyst. Lundefugle yngler mellem maj og august på denne ø, som er dækket af små bakker og skråninger og kendt for sit farverige fugleliv. Da øens kyster er stenede, er din søpapegøje-båd specielt designet til at komme dig så tæt på kystlinjen som muligt, så du kan få et nærmere kig på disse yndige skabninger! Lær om bord af din ekspertguide om søpapegøjerne samt andre interessante havfugle, som du kan se på turen, såsom havmuler, måger, polarterner og lomvier. Nyd at se havfuglene flyve og dykke i vandet. Når du ankommer til en af lundeøerne, skal du cirkulere rundt om dem for mere observationstid, før kaptajnen slukker for motorerne, så du kan nyde freden og roen blandt Islands naturskatte.
